CPS Map-Web
CPS Map-Web is a leading-edge Internet solution that provides a valuable web site for the community, heightening public awareness of crime with education and data. A free email notification keeps subscribers tuned in to weekly reports.

CAPABILITIES

Mapping Tools are made available on a law enforcement agency web site, or on a separate site for public use. Public domain data sets provide the detail that generates crime activity maps giving community members an insight into crime activity in their neighborhoods and city. Citizens can select crime data “types” they want to view, and a map is generated reflecting activity within a specified time period.

Custom Options are available. Agency hosts may have CPS Map-Web reside on their web site, or private label the web site as part of a larger “community safety” effort. They may narrowly define citizen search options, or provide broad access to public data in a user-friendly map format. And, matters of confidentiality are highly respected—incident locations and address information is not revealed.

System Requirements:

  • Windows 2000 Professional, or newer
  • ODBC compliant database (such as Oracle, SQL Server, Sybase, Informix DB2, MS Access)
  • Access to file/record layouts (data dictionary)
  • Ongoing access to agency-specific GIS data
